About the project: Synopsis: Hands on a Hardbody takes place at a Nissan dealership in Longview, Texas, where ten contestants try to outlast each other to win a brand new red truck by keeping at least one hand on it as long as they can. Every character needs the truck to help change their lives for the better and to win their American dream. We see them struggle through the heat and exhaustion with humor, ambition, and hope.
